Frequently Asked Questions

How do I prepare my yard before Two Brother Tree Service arrives?
Clear any vehicles, outdoor furniture, or fragile items from the area around the tree before the crew arrives. If you have pets, keep them indoors during the job for their safety.
Can Two Brother Tree Service work in tight Omaha residential backyards?
Yes, working in confined residential spaces is a standard part of urban tree work in Omaha. Experienced crews know how to plan cuts and use rigging to control where limbs fall, protecting fences, gardens, and nearby structures.
What should I do if a tree falls on my property during an Omaha storm?
If there's immediate danger to your home or utilities, call 911 first to report downed power lines. Once it's safe, contact a local tree service to assess the damage and begin cleanup as soon as they can get to you.
Do I need to be home when the tree crew is working?
It's helpful to be available at the start of the job to confirm the scope of work and answer any questions the crew might have. Many homeowners don't stay for the entire job, but being reachable by phone is a good idea.
How long does a typical tree removal take in Omaha?
A single residential tree removal often takes a few hours from setup to cleanup, though larger trees or more complex situations can take longer. Your provider should give you a rough time estimate before they start.
Will removing a tree damage my lawn?
Some minor lawn disturbance is normal, especially with large equipment or when dragging debris out. A good crew takes care to minimize impact and can advise you on how to reseed or repair any affected areas afterward.
